#Software development process
Explore tagged Tumblr posts
Text
#Adaptive Software Development#Agile Methodologies#Software Development Process#Iterative Development#Project Management in Software Engineering
0 notes
Text
0 notes
Text
#Custom Software Development#Bespoke Software Solutions#Tailored Software#Software Development Process#Business Software Solutions#Digital Transformation#IT Development Services#Custom App Development#Software Engineering#Technology Innovation
1 note
·
View note
Text
In today’s fast-paced digital world, the speedy website is now not just a pleasing-to-have; it is a must-have. A slow website can drive visitors away, harm your search engine ratings, and negatively affect your bottom line.
As a front-end developer, you could substantially enhance the website’s overall performance. Following these 11 expert tips, you could get website speed optimization, enrich the user experience, and improve your bottom line.
Let’s dive in and find out how to make your websites lightning-fast! So, what’re you waiting for?
Let’s begin!
0 notes
Text
A Step-By-Step Guide to Software Development Process
Ever wondered how your favorite apps or software are built? The software development process is like baking a cake—it requires the right ingredients, steps, and a lot of patience! Here’s a quick overview:
Idea & Planning: Define what you want to build and why.
Design: Create a blueprint of your software.
Development: Write the code and build the product.
Testing: Check for bugs and ensure everything works perfectly.
Deployment: Release the software to users.
Maintenance: Keep improving and updating the software.
Want to dive deeper into each step? Check out our full blog: A Step-By-Step Guide to Software Development Process
1 note
·
View note
Text
Best Practices in Software Development: Writing Clean and Efficient Code
Introduction
In today's technology-driven world, software development is pivotal for businesses and individuals aiming to innovate and streamline operations. It encompasses the entire process of designing, coding, testing, and maintaining software applications to meet specific needs. Whether you're a startup, a large corporation, or an individual entrepreneur, investing in software development ensures efficient processes and a competitive edge.
Types of Software Development
Front-End Development
Focuses on the user interface and experience, utilizing technologies like HTML, CSS, and JavaScript to create interactive and visually appealing applications.
Back-End Development
Manages server-side logic, databases, and application integration, ensuring that the software functions correctly behind the scenes.
Full-Stack Development
Combines both front-end and back-end development skills, enabling developers to build comprehensive applications from start to finish.
Mobile Application Development
Involves creating applications specifically designed for mobile devices, using platforms like iOS and Android.
Embedded Systems Development
Focuses on developing software for specialized hardware systems, such as automotive controls or medical devices.
Key Technologies in Software Development
Programming Languages: JavaScript, Python, Java, C#, and C++ are among the most commonly used languages.
Frameworks and Libraries: React, Angular, Django, and .NET aid in building robust applications efficiently.
Databases: Systems like MySQL, PostgreSQL, and MongoDB are used to store and manage data effectively.
Version Control Systems: Tools like Git help in tracking changes and collaborating on codebases.
Benefits of Professional Software Development Services
Customized Solutions: Tailored software meets specific business requirements, enhancing efficiency.
Scalability: Professionally developed software can grow with your business needs.
Security: Implementing best practices ensures data protection and minimizes vulnerabilities.
Maintenance and Support: Ongoing support ensures the software remains up-to-date and functional.
How to Choose the Right Software Development Service Provider
Experience and Expertise: Look for providers with a proven track record in your industry.
Portfolio and Case Studies: Review past projects to assess quality and relevance.
Client Testimonials: Positive feedback indicates reliability and satisfaction.
Communication and Collaboration: Ensure they have a transparent process and are open to feedback.
Common Challenges in Software Development
Requirement Changes: Evolving needs can lead to scope creep if not managed properly.
Technical Debt: Compromises in code quality for quick delivery can cause future issues.
Integration Issues: Ensuring new software works seamlessly with existing systems.
Resource Constraints: Limited time, budget, or skilled personnel can impact project success.
Future Trends in Software Development
Artificial Intelligence and Machine Learning: Integrating AI to create smarter applications.
Cloud Computing: Leveraging cloud platforms for scalable and flexible solutions.
DevOps Practices: Combining development and operations for faster delivery cycles.
Internet of Things (IoT): Developing software for interconnected devices.
Conclusion
Investing in professional software development is crucial for organizations aiming to stay competitive and efficient in the modern landscape. By leveraging the right technologies and expertise, businesses can create solutions that drive success and innovation.
FAQs
What is the average cost of software development services?
Costs vary widely based on project complexity, scope, and location of the development team. It's best to obtain quotes from multiple providers.
How long does it take to develop a software application?
Timelines depend on the project's size and complexity; simple applications may take a few months, while larger systems can take a year or more.
What is the difference between front-end and back-end development?
Front-end development deals with the user interface and experience, while back-end development focuses on server-side logic and database interactions.
Can I update my software application after development?
Yes, regular updates are essential for adding features, improving performance, and ensuring security.
Why is mobile responsiveness important in software development?
With the increasing use of mobile devices, ensuring applications work well on various screen sizes enhances user experience and accessibility.
#Software Development Services#•#Software Development Languages#Software Development Outsourcing#Agile Software Development#Software Development Lifecycle#Software Development Methodologies#Software Development Process
0 notes
Text
supply chain management (SCM)
As an industry-leading company in the technology sector, AvienTech Software excels in providing exceptional supply chain management (SCM) solutions. With our innovative approach and cutting-edge software, we enable businesses to optimize their entire supply chain process. From procurement to fulfillment, our SCM platform seamlessly integrates every aspect, ensuring efficiency, transparency, and cost-effectiveness. By automating and streamlining key processes, AvienTech empowers organizations to make informed decisions, improve collaboration with suppliers, reduce lead times, and enhance customer satisfaction. With our comprehensive SCM solutions, businesses can gain a competitive edge and achieve supply chain excellence.

0 notes
Text
Streamlining Software Development: Continuous Testing for DevOps Integration

With the software development environment changes in an ongoing effect, the relation between development and operations have moved from being a separate function to a collaborative one. A notable effect of organizations’ quest to meet up with short periods of software delivery timelines at a top-most quality is the widespread adoption of DevOps practices. By the core of this union we mean continuing testing, a method that integrates testing with development and operations in a continuous and smooth manner.
Blockverse Infotech Solutions which is engaged in the software industry is definitely a place to point to be an innovating leader of excellence in delivering software. With a mix of advanced technological solutions and practical execution, BlockVerse Infotech Solutions exemplify the paradigm shift in software engineering. Firstly, they realize that speed and quality are at the core of DevOps and they understand that continuous testing is what makes great DevOps come true.
The working of continuous testing differs from the traditional methods as testing activities are not in a separate phase but are smoothly merged into the delivery of software. In the entire software development lifecycle, whether at the stage of development, deployment, or even after, thorough testing is deemed paramount as it enables the software to go through rigorous evaluation process. Such is the case since software projects with more continuous testing has higher reliability.
Automation is one of the most significant precepts of the continuous testing as well. Whereas test cases can be automated and integrated into the CI/CD pipeline so as to make the feedback cycles fast, this leads to early errors detection and resolution, before the products are released to the end users. It is not only the rate of the process that improves but also increases the PHP development quality.
Additionally, repeated testing encourages collaboration amongst different teams that unveil their functions to result in a shared culture of committed performance. The intersection of development, testing, and operations teams brings forth to the fore the combined expertise of all the involved groups which furthering development and efficiency throughout the software lifecycle.
Organizations that choose a CI culture are able to reap a lot of advantages including shorter time to market, reduced costs and highercustomer satisfaction among other many benefits. Along with that, it helps them acquire the same level of flexibility to react immediately to the shifts in the market integrated nature of digital markets and take advantage of those events in the digital space.
Summarizing, DevOps culture cannot be realized without CI/CD. It reinforces congenial environment for continuous delivery of changes and minimizes risks, making the software market as relevant and appropriate as possible. Adopting DevOps strategy as a key organizational tenant is all the more important as the team embarks on testing that continues to be a foundation of its plans. As such, they are able to open new windows for expansion and innovative work, thus offering a sustainable solution under any market conditions.
#software development process#software development company#software development agency#software development business#software development companies near me#software development engineer#software development applications#software development freelance#lead software developer
0 notes
Text
Types Of Software Development: Explained | SynergyTop
Embark on a journey into the realm of software development with our latest blog! SynergyTop unveils the Types Of Software Development, demystifying the tech landscape. From web development to mobile apps, our comprehensive guide breaks down each type, offering insights for tech enthusiasts and businesses alike. Stay ahead in the digital era by understanding the nuances of software development. Explore the synergy between technology and innovation with SynergyTop's illuminating blog post.
#software development company#software developer#software development process#types of software development
0 notes
Text
1 note
·
View note
Text

7 Ways to Perfect Your Software Development Process
Enhance your software development methodology to optimize both efficiency and quality, uncovering essential strategies for achieving success in the realm of software development.
#Software Development Process#YES IT Labs#software development#software development methodology#streamlined development process
0 notes
Text
WebfyMedia Software Development & Services Development in Noida
the software development Security and scalability are integral aspects of our development journey. Our architecture is designed with security best practices in mind, ensuring that sensitive data remains protected. Additionally, our solutions are built to scale, software development accommodating growing user bases without compromising performance Our solutions to the most complex and collaborative development and team of dedicated developers ,and designers, and engineers converge to create a synergy that drives the software development process the full potential of your business with our top-notch software development services. From custom web applications to mobile app development, our team of experts will bring your ideas to life. Partner with us for scalable solutions that drive growth and success in today's digital landscape. The heart of our software development methodology lies in Agile principles. Through iterative cycles, we build, test, and refine software components. This enables us to respond swiftly to changes and new insights, avoiding pitfalls associated with traditional linear development models. By embracing change as a constant, we maintain a competitive edge in a tech landscape characterized by rapid advancements.

#software development#software development skills#software development best practices#software developer career#software development process
0 notes
Text
0 notes
Text
How to Choose a Software Development Framework in 2023?
Understanding what are software development frameworks is essential for any business looking to build scalable and maintainable software solutions.
These frameworks offer a structured approach to development by providing a set of pre-defined components, libraries, and best practices.
Most importantly, they help businesses avoid having to reinvent the wheel and focus their efforts on core business activities.
However, choosing the right software development for your project requires careful consideration. There are plenty of various factors like project requirements, performance, security, cost-effectiveness, etc. to factor in your decision-making process.
Read More: Software Development Framework
#software development framework#software development process#software developer#framework#software framework#latest software framework
0 notes
Text
API development is a cornerstone for contemporary applications in today’s hyper-related virtual world. APIs (Application Programming Interfaces) empower developers to integrate various systems and create seamless and enriched experiences, making them indispensable in app development.
This article illuminates you on why APIs matter and how businesses can leverage them for success.
So, what’re you waiting for? Let’s delve deep into the world of API development.
Happy reading!
#api development#Application Programming Interfaces#apis#app development#mobile app development#software development process
0 notes
Text
#API Testing Services#Automation Testing Services#Binary Informatics#Manual Testing Services#Mobile App Testing Services#Offshore QA Expertise#on-demand testing services#Performance Testing Services#QA experts#QA offshore#QA processes#QA providers#QA services#quality assurance#Security Testing Services#software development process#Software Testing Company#Testing Approach
0 notes